LinkedIn is updating its feed algorithm to include dwell time as a ranking factor. If you’re unfamiliar with dwell time, it’s the amount of time users spend on a particular piece of content. Google Merchant Center Now Integrated With PayPal
Are you running an e-commerce website that uses PayPal as a payment option? If so, then you’ll be happy to learn that Google Merchant Center now integrates with PayPal.
